Abstract
Recently, we suggested a novel swelling method to make polymer seed pa rticles absorb a large amount of monomer prior to the seeded polymeriz ation for preparing monodispersed polymer particles having diameter ab ove 5 mu m, which we named the ''dynamic swelling method.'' This artic le discusses the thermodynamic background of this method, both theoret ically and experimentally. (C) 1996 John Wiley & Sons, Inc.
